So Many Ways to Begin by Jon Mcgregor
Museum curator David's life is not what he hoped or expected - his identity is, shockingly, undermined, depression strikes his young wife, he loses his beloved job. 'Curating' relics of his mother's life, listening to his wife's childhood stories, the past piece by piece illuminates the present. This is a story of ordinary people surviving disappointments and how a deep-rooted love can survive these - and the greatest disappointment of all (read it to see!).
(Annabel Bedini - bwl 60 Spring 2011 )
